About the Department

The Development Innovation Lab at the University of Chicago uses the tools of economics to develop innovations with the potential to benefit millions of people in low- and middle-income countries. It was founded and is led by Nobel laureate Michael Kremer.


Job Summary

The job plans, prepares and disseminates information designed to keep the public informed of the University's perspectives, programs, and accomplishments. Work is performed with a moderate level of guidance, and typically includes marketing, press relations, creative editorial and design services, and internal communications.

The Policy & Communications Associate will help raise DIL’s digital profile by increasing our digital presence and supporting broader communications objectives. This role will coordinate with research and policy staff to turn complex economics and policy research into compelling digital content. This position will be responsible for updating content on DIL’s website, social media, and other digital platforms, and will use performance data and analytics to maximize reach and impact.

The ideal candidate has strong project management, writing, and editing skills, and a strong interest in DIL’s mission. This role requires someone who can translate complex research into plain language for lay audiences, coordinate content across multiple internal teams and external communication channels, and create polished, professional policy materials.

This role offers the opportunity to achieve a big impact on lives globally and gain exposure and experience in the international development field at an innovative organization led by Nobel Prize winning economist Michael Kremer.

Responsibilities

  • Updates content on the DIL website on a regular basis to ensure information is precise, accurate, current, well-organized, optimized for user experience, and compelling to target audiences, including policymakers, partners, donors, and other stakeholders.
  • In coordination with senior leadership, help develop new digital features for the DIL website, including new project and event pages.
  • Plans and drafts regular social media posts aligned with new research results, project updates, and evolving organizational priorities, primarily on LinkedIn and X.
  • Identifies and executes creative ways to highlight students, staff, and alumni on digital channels.
  • Develops and tracks communications metrics to quantify website and social media reach and engagement and inform recommendations for improvement.
  • Boosts DIL participation in external events by coordinating, creating and disseminating event-related content, including through press releases, multimedia, and social media.
  • Supports field teams to engage local photographers and ensure regular production of visual content.
  • Writes and edits content that translates complex research into engaging, plain-language summaries suitable for broad audiences on DIL’s website, social media platforms, and targeted emails, in collaboration with internal subject matter experts.
  • Coordinates production of press releases for DIL team members and dissemination to targeted media outlets, both in the US and overseas.
  • Supports the creation of funding pitch decks, donor communications, reports, and other projects as assigned.
  • Strengthens internal communications templates, guidelines, and trainings to equip staff members with tools for effective communications and audience engagement, in coordination with DIL leadership
  • Collaborates with recruitment managers to ensure job postings are disseminated widely to relevant audiences.
  • Collaborates with staff across international locations to hire and manage freelance photographers as needed; organizes and maintains an internal digital photo library showcasing DIL’s research and policy work.
  • Supports administration ofcommunications contracts for web development, graphic design, photography, and other work as needed.
  • Collaborates with internal subject matter experts to understand key communications goals and needs, coordinate with leadership to align goals across teams, and create internal resources to meet team needs.
  • Helps build a proactive media engagement strategy aligned with current events, in coordination with senior leadership.
  • Monitors brand consistency across print and digital channels
  • Strengthens internal systems for content production, review, and clearance.
  • Plans, develops and disseminates information designed to keep the public informed of the organization's programs, accomplishments, or point of view, with moderate levels of guidance and direction.
  • Continues to build higher level knowledge of the University, processes and customers.
  • Performs other related work as needed.


Minimum Qualifications

Education:

Minimum requirements include a college or university degree in related field.


Work Experience:

Minimum requirements include knowledge and skills developed through 2-5 years of work experience in a related job discipline.


Certifications:

---

Preferred Qualifications

Education:

  • Bachelors degree.

Experience:

  • Demonstrated experience communicating complex research findings and policy recommendations. Candidates may be recent graduates with related internships, or with past experience in communications, research, and/or international development.
  • Masters degree in economics, public policy, communications, journalism or a related field.
  • Excellent written and oral communication skills.
  • Familiarity with design tools (e.g., Canva, Adobe Creative Suite) and content management systems (e.g., WordPress).
  • Coursework in economics and/or demonstrated success communicating evidence-based policy.
  • Intermediate-level training in economics and/or public policy (econometrics, statistics, quantitative analysis training).
  • Experience translating complex research into plain-language content for a mainstream policy audience.

Preferred Competencies

  • Demonstrated success supporting multiple-platform engagement strategies.
  • Ability to write engaging content with close attention to detail, precision, and accuracy to research findings.
  • Ability to coordinate effectively across international teams and locations and adapt working style to different professional contexts.
  • Comfort using website/social media analytics to shape, refine approach.
  • Strong organization skills with high attention to detail.
  • Ability to work on and prioritize multiple tasks.
  • Ability to work well under pressure and meet deadlines.

Working Conditions

  • This is a hybrid position with at least expected three days in-person per week.
  • Candidates must be willing to travel flexibly as needed for their respective responsibilities.
